Baldia factory case: non-bailable warrants for key accused issued

29 May, 2016

A local court in Karachi on Saturday remarked that the provincial government is not serious in Baldia Town factory fire case as the matter has lingered on since 2012. Session Court West heard the case amid tight security arrangements on Saturday. Rangers law officer, member of investigation committee SP Sajid Sadozai, lawyers of factory owners and lawyer of a local NGO were present in the court.
During the case hearing, the state lawyer informed court that the Sindh Home Department has the real JIT. The court remarked that this JIT will only benefit police and not the court. Neither the Home department nor police are serious in the matter. Order given to the Inspector General of Police (IGP) has not been implemented yet. Everything is there but no one is taking any action, the court stated. Meanwhile, the court on Saturday once again issued non-bailable arrest warrants for the fugitive suspect Mansoor in Baldia Town factory case. In the hearing of the case, the Sindh government presented a two-page report before the court. Upon hearing the arguments, the court adjourned the hearing till July 16.
